Traditional food market. It works both in the morning and in the evening. You can find traditional Balinese spices. In the evenings, a lot of prepared food is sold.

Local market with fruits and vegetables at affordable prices.
The market opens at 5 AM.
Prices, like at other markets, are cheaper than in supermarkets. Great for experiencing the local atmosphere.
